'89 Isuzu Trooper Problems

'89 Trooper: 2.8L V-6 (Chevy) / TBI / Five-speed Manual / 4WD / 277,000 miles

When I turn on my defroster, the engine idle soars up to about 2500 rpm and the defroster doesn’t work. I see that the heater unit has a vacuum actuator – probably for the defroster – so I’m guessing the problem is a vacuum leak. I’m currently replacing the vac hoses to the heater. The idle also wanders up and down occasionally and, when revved, the engine takes a while to idle down properly. Any other suggestions or ideas that I might check?